Product Overview Product description The new generation of the EA-30XP comes with leading binocular vision system and ultra-low terrain follow technology, allowing the drone to automatically avoid obstacles in fertile fields, hilly and mountainous terrains. The mist nozzle produces droplets to penetrate various kinds of crops. For spreading operations, users can purchase the optional spread package to transform the drone into spread configuration.

Remote Controller Remote controller overview The EAVISION remote controller adopts the advanced high-definition image transmission technology, and can automatically select the frequency band with the lowest interference. Equipped with an omnidirectional antenna, the image transmission and control distance can reach 1.2 to 1.8 kilometers. Its powerful computing performance reduces video transmission display delay to 180ms with Qualcomm eight-core CPU.

Smart Battery Smart battery overview EA-30XP intelligent flight battery adopts a new high-energy density battery cell and an advanced battery management system to provide sufficient power for the drone. Metal casing and silicone protective cover effectively protect the battery. The battery capacity is 29000mAh and the nominal voltage is 51.8V Smart battery components 1.

extremely efficient. The maximum charging power of the charger can reach 7200W. After connecting to the charging management App through Bluetooth, users can monitor the status of the charger and battery cells in real time. The intelligent charging management system can adjust the charging current according to the battery status, and the charger has multiple intelligent protection functions to avoid damage from over- temperature, over-voltage, under-voltage, short circuit and ensure charging safety.

RTK Base Station Product overview EAV-BAS30 is a high-precision satellite signal receiver, which can receive BEIDOU, GPS, Galileo, GLONASS, and other satellite signals. Equipped with the wireless data transmission radio, the built-in high-precision RTK module, and the surveying tool, it ensures the autonomous operations of the drone in areas with weak or no network.

3. The principle of GoHome height is as follows, Let’s say the operating height is X, GoHome height increment is Y, then GoHome Height = X + Y. And GoHome Height to Obstacle Height is Z. When the drone returns, it finishes operation with operating height of X, flies to the transition point, then flies with the height of X+Y.
